Let's start with the frame. The frame is like the backbone of the single trampoline. Most of the time, it's made from galvanized steel. Galvanized steel is steel that's been coated with a layer of zinc. Why is this so great? Well, zinc acts as a protective shield against rust and corrosion. You know how metal can start to look all yucky and flaky when it gets wet and exposed to the elements? That's rust, and it can really weaken the structure of the trampoline. With galvanized steel, you can leave your Single Trampoline outside without having to worry too much about it falling apart due to rust. It's also pretty strong and durable, which means it can handle the constant stress of people jumping up and down on the trampoline.


Now, onto the jumping mat. This is where the real action happens! The jumping mat is usually made from polypropylene. Polypropylene is a type of plastic, but don't let that scare you. It's designed to be really tough and flexible. It has a high tensile strength, which means it can stretch a lot without tearing. When you jump on the trampoline, the mat stretches and then snaps back into place, giving you that awesome bounce. Polypropylene is also resistant to UV rays. If you've ever left a plastic item outside in the sun for too long, you might have noticed it starting to fade or become brittle. But polypropylene can withstand the sun's rays, so your jumping mat will stay in good condition for a long time.
Next up are the springs. Springs are what give the trampoline its bounce. They're typically made from high - carbon steel. High - carbon steel is super strong and can handle a lot of tension. When you jump on the trampoline, the springs stretch and store energy. Then, when you start to come back down, the springs release that energy, pushing you back up into the air. This continuous cycle of stretching and releasing is what makes trampolining so much fun. The quality of the springs is really important. If the springs are too weak, you won't get a good bounce. And if they're not made from the right material, they might break or lose their elasticity over time.
The padding is another crucial part of the single trampoline. The padding covers the frame and the springs to protect you from getting hurt. It's usually made from foam covered with vinyl. The foam provides a soft cushion, so if you accidentally bump into the frame or the springs, it won't hurt as much. The vinyl covering is tough and waterproof. It protects the foam from getting wet and damaged. Plus, it's easy to clean. You can just wipe it down with a damp cloth if it gets dirty.
Some single trampolines also come with a safety net. Safety nets are made from a strong, woven material, often polyethylene. Polyethylene is similar to polypropylene in that it's a type of plastic. It's lightweight but very strong. The net is designed to prevent you from falling off the trampoline. It's usually attached to the frame with strong ropes or clips. The mesh size of the net is small enough to keep you from slipping through, but big enough to let air pass through, so you don't feel like you're in a stuffy cage.
Let's talk about some of the different types of single trampolines and how the materials might vary. For example, the 14ft Trampoline is a popular size. Because it's larger, it needs a stronger frame and more springs to support the weight of multiple people or just to handle the increased stress. The jumping mat on a 14 - foot trampoline might be made from a higher - grade polypropylene to ensure it can stretch and bounce properly over a larger area.
Then there's the Pumpkin Trampoline. This is a fun - shaped trampoline that looks like a pumpkin. The materials used are still the same in terms of the frame, jumping mat, springs, and padding. But the design might require some extra engineering to make sure the unique shape doesn't affect the performance of the trampoline. The frame might need to be specially shaped, and the springs might need to be arranged in a different pattern to ensure an even bounce across the entire surface.
